Can a novel written online be published?
It could be published. Although the Internet provided many conveniences for writing and publishing, the traditional publishing process still required some steps and time. First of all, you need to upload your work to a writing platform such as Qidian Chinese Network. These platforms provided a series of writing and publishing services, including writing guides, reader interaction, work review, publishing contracts, and so on. Once your work has been approved by the platform, you can start thinking, writing, editing, and proofreading. After completing the first draft, you need to submit it for review. Only after it has been reviewed by the platform editor and the publishing agency can you enter the publishing process. Then, you can apply to various publishing agencies such as publishing houses, book number agencies, etc. These organizations would edit, format, proofread, and print the work before finally releasing it to the market. It was important to note that writing and publishing works on the Internet required compliance with relevant laws and regulations, including copyright protection, compensation for copyright infringement, etc. Therefore, you need to handle your work carefully to avoid unnecessary disputes.

Can online reading replace written reading?
Online reading can replace written reading in some cases, but it can't completely replace written reading. The advantage of reading online was that it was convenient and fast. Reading online could be done anywhere, anytime, and there was no need to bring a paper book or laptop. In addition, online reading could also be done through various devices such as mobile phones, tablets, or computers. Reading online could also save time and energy. Reading online can save time and energy by skipping certain chapters or pages. In addition, online reading can also be done through the search function to find the required information without having to read from the beginning. However, there were some disadvantages to reading online. Reading online lacked the touch and atmosphere of reading in books, and the reading experience might not be as good as reading in books. Online reading also couldn't provide the visual and auditory effects such as font, color, typography, and audio playback that could be obtained from written reading. Therefore, although online reading could replace written reading in some cases, it could not completely replace written reading. The readers still needed printed books to obtain more comprehensive and in-depth knowledge.
